About

Joseph Allen Reynolds III is a business attorney with over 43 years of legal experience, practicing at Evans Jones & Reynolds in Nashville, TN. He attended Alabama, University of, University of Alabama - School of Law, and University of Alabama. He has been admitted to the Tennessee Bar since 1983. His practice encompasses business, estate planning, tax, and trusts,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
